Suggestion for Implementation:

  • Customized Insurance Products: One potential approach could involve collaborating with insurance providers to develop customized insurance products tailored specifically to the needs of crypto investors and businesses. These products could offer flexible coverage options, competitive premiums, and streamlined claims processes, addressing the unique risks associated with crypto assets.

    Smart Contract Integration: Leveraging blockchain technology, insurance policies could be encoded as smart contracts, automating the insurance process and enhancing transparency and efficiency. Smart contract-based insurance solutions could enable instant payouts in the event of predefined triggers, eliminating the need for lengthy claims procedures and reducing administrative overhead.

    Community-Powered Insurance Pools: Another intriguing idea is the creation of community-powered insurance pools, where participants collectively contribute funds to establish a reserve pool for covering potential losses. Through decentralized governance mechanisms, participants could vote on coverage terms, claim settlements, and risk management strategies, fostering a sense of ownership and accountability within the community.

Any crypto insurance platform is inherently going to be risky because it is going to be a prime target for hackers.

Speaking about hackers, have you ever visited web3isgoinggreat.com?  It tells you about so many hacks that have happened in the news.

Now imagine if you had to insure even half of them. That would make you bankrupt pretty quick, no?

The business model of insurance platforms is that people have to be paying you more than they lose.

In contrast to the opinions above, I think insurance is necessary, that is, if you are running a centralized service or a custodial platform. People shouldn't just deposit their funds and trust the platform. Surely, it isn't enough to be told that their funds are SAFU, that their services are reliable and trustworthy, that the security of their users' funds are a priority. The history of crypto is replete with exit scams, hacks, rug pulls, bankruptcy, and the like. Insurance would be of great help.

I don't know how a smart contract-based insurance could be made fair and secure, but I doubt a community-powered insurance pool is a wise choice. I prefer collaborating with independent insurance providers that have long and solid track records.
